Since 1992, our philosophy of doing business, core values and commitment to providing the best in food, wine, and customer service along with an authentic passion for Italian culture has proven itself with the test of time. Our family run business has now grown over the years into a multi-faceted operation, Terroni/Sud Forno, encompassing restaurants, bakeries, commissaries and retail in Toronto and Los Angeles, operating under the brands Terroni, Sud Forno, Spaccio, Cavinona Wine Agency, and La Bottega di Terroni online shop. The Logistics Coordinator oversees the day-to-day operations of the shipping and receiving department, including team management, dispatch coordination, product quality control, and cross-departmental communication. This is a ground-level operations role with direct accountability for departmental standards and team performance.

Responsibilities

  • Oversee all incoming and outgoing product movement for accuracy and timeliness
  • Enforce receiving standards (FIFO, ice removal, walk-in cleanliness, fridge maintenance)
  • Stage outbound orders and communicate same-day product discrepancies to relevant departments
  • Act as primary dispatch for all drivers; assign and optimize delivery routes
  • Monitor route progress and resolve delays in real time
  • Management of the dispatching platform, including routing and scheduling drivers
  • Inspect incoming product and verify accuracy of all outbound shipments
  • Conduct quality checks on product handed off from all departments prior to shipping
  • Document and escalate non-conforming product immediately
  • Oversee and verify all Pick Sheet tasks to ensure order accuracy before staging
  • Reconcile invoices against purchase orders and received goods
  • Maintain accurate records and liaise with the invoicing team on discrepancies
  • Enforce health and safety regulations within the department
  • Document and report workplace incidents per WSIB/Ontario requirements
  • Identify and mitigate hazards proactively
  • Manage day-to-day performance and accountability of the shipping and receiving team
  • Provide on-floor coaching and direction; escalate conduct issues as appropriate
  • Serve as the primary logistics contact across locations, departments, and invoicing
  • Maintain timely, accurate communication on shipment status, product issues, and updates
